Self-custody vs custodial 

The Argent Metal Card, Argent Lite Card, and Gnosis Pay are fully self-custodial, which is better for security, as you control your private keys. 

Holyheld is a hybrid. It’s a custodial card that works with a self-custodial wallet. You can top up the card account as you see fit. Bybit and Crypto.com’s cards are custodial. You rely on them to store your crypto for you.

Cashback

All crypto cards offer cashback to varying degrees. Both Gnosis Pay and Crypto.com require you to stake their native tokens, whereas Argent and Holyheld do not. 

Argent Metal Card offers the highest cashback, 10%, in your first 30 days. After that, the cashback rate is reduced to 3%. You can earn $150 in cashback rewards every month. That's $1,800 in year one.

Fees

None of the crypto cards charge FX fees other than Bybit and Crypto.com. The Argent Metal Card does not charge gas, off-ramp, top-up, conversion, or ATM fees (up to $800/month). 1 USDC = $1.

Top up flexibility

The Argent Metal Card, Crypto.com and Bybit don’t require you to use a separate account to top-up your card account, whereas Gnosis requires swapping into GBPe in that separate account.

Availability 

Most cards are available in the UK and EEA. Gnosis Pay and Crypto.com offer additional jurisdictions. Argent is expanding to other regions in 2025. 

Apple Pay/Google Pay

Apple Pay and Google Pay support will soon be available for Argent and Gnosis Pay. Holyheld and Crypto.com offer support today.
